BMW unveils sixth-generation eDrive technology

The BMW Group has announced advancements with its sixth-generation eDrive technology, referred to as Gen6. This new technology is characterized by a 30 percent increase in charging speed and range, with certain models expected to exceed these figures. This is the most powerful Rolls-Royce in history

Rolls-Royce Motor Cars has introduced the Black Badge Spectre to the world. This model features distinctive exterior finishes and interior details, alongside enhanced opportunities for bespoke customization.
